ReceiveBuffer bei upload
Diese Zeile gibt:
Dieses Ergebniss: 8192 from 9151 max 8192
Meine Frage: welche Nachteile ergeben sich aus dem heraufsetzen von
|
|
Quellcode |
1 2 3 4 5 6 7 8 9 10 11 |
while(in.available()!=wrapper.uploadSize)
{
System.out.println(in.available() + " from "+wrapper.uploadSize
+ " max "+socket.getReceiveBufferSize());
try {
Thread.currentThread().sleep(10);
} catch (InterruptedException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
}
|
Dieses Ergebniss: 8192 from 9151 max 8192
Meine Frage: welche Nachteile ergeben sich aus dem heraufsetzen von
|
|
PHP-Quelltext |
1 |
socket.setReceiveBufferSize()
|
Dein Beispiel - code ist sehr kurz gehalten, um zu verstehen, worum es geht.
größerer Puffer - mehr Arbeitsspeicher
eventuell wären die Paketgrößen(TCP/IP) bei einer Erhöhung des Puffers zu berücksichtigen. könnte ansonsten eventuell verschenkter Platz sein, wenn der Puffer nicht sinnig gefüllt werden kann, da der Puffer ja durch die Paketgröße teilbar sein sollte( berichtigt mich, wenn ich hier falsch liege) ... oder habe ich dich mißverstanden??
größerer Puffer - mehr Arbeitsspeicher
eventuell wären die Paketgrößen(TCP/IP) bei einer Erhöhung des Puffers zu berücksichtigen. könnte ansonsten eventuell verschenkter Platz sein, wenn der Puffer nicht sinnig gefüllt werden kann, da der Puffer ja durch die Paketgröße teilbar sein sollte( berichtigt mich, wenn ich hier falsch liege) ... oder habe ich dich mißverstanden??


